Introduction The Australian children's television program Play School spans more than 40 years of early childhood experience within Australia, and a retrospective view of the program highlights the emergence of different philosophical and pedagogical perspectives that impact on early childhood practice. This paper outlines the processes behind the production of Play School, the philosophical foundation for the program, and more recent considerations in response to contemporary perspectives in early childhood education. As for educators working in other early childhood contexts in Australia, the members of the Play School production team are also challenged to deconstruct past practices and interrogate uncontested assumptions about childhood experience. The complexities and contradictions which emerge offer new possibilities and challenges to explore.
